The VXIpc-770, identified by part numbers 778299-00 and 778299-01, is a single-slot VXI controller that offers robust performance for embedded computing applications. At its core, it features a 566 MHz Celeron processor, paired with an Intel 815E chipset and an Intel 82815 integrated graphics controller, ensuring a reliable and efficient operation.
Designed for compatibility with VXIplug&play standards, the VXIpc-770 integrates seamlessly into a wide range of test and measurement environments. It stands out with its 1-slot VXI Controller form factor, making it a compact yet powerful solution for various applications.
For time-keeping and system management, it features a lithium, battery-backed real-time watch, alongside an NI watchdog for application monitoring, ensuring system stability and reliability. Connectivity is enhanced with 2 SMB connectors for TTL trigger line routing, supporting all VXI-defined protocols on ECL and P2 trigger lines.
The VXIpc-770 is equipped with an internal counter capable of counting, generating variable-length pulses, pulse trains, and pulse stretching, offering versatile functionality for complex tasks. Additionally, it supports external devices such as a USB CD-ROM drive, expanding its utility and flexibility in system configurations.

|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Part Numbers | 778299-00, 778299-01 |
| Model | VXIpc-770 |
| Processor | 566 MHz Celeron |
| Chipset | Intel 815E |
| Graphics Controller | Intel 82815 integrated |
| Compatibility | VXIplug&play |
| Form Factor | 1-slot VXI Controller |
| Battery | Lithium, battery-backed real-time watch |
| Watchdog | NI watchdog for application monitoring |
| Trigger I/O Connectors | 2 SMB for TTL trigger line routing |
| Protocol Support | Responds to all VXI-defined protocols on ECL and P2 trigger lines |
| Internal Counter | For counting, generating variable-length pulses, pulse trains, and pulse stretching |
| External Device Support | USB CD-ROM drive attachment capability |
